Bret Schundler signed an agreement to allow the development of a road, a parking lot and boat ramps into Jersey's City's Split Rock Reservoir. This project would destroy a pristine area that helps protect water quality in the reservoir. Buffers around reservoirs are considered one of the most important ways to filter water naturally. Not only will this destroy the buffer, but also the runoff of gas, oil and antifreeze from cars will pollute the reservoir. Motorboats will also be allowed. At a time when there are heightened concerns about protecting our water supplies, having new access points added to reservoirs will only raise more fears and concerns with the general public.

This spring, when a DEP report showed that the granting of a water allocation permit to the new Morris County golf course in Jefferson would deplete Jersey City's Boonton Reservoir, once again Bret Schundler kept quiet. The report showed that not only would the golf course deplete the amount of water in both the Rockaway River and the Boonton Reservoir, but also that it would have such an adverse impact that the DEP felt the resident's of Jersey City should be compensated by Morris County. This happened during the primary season when Bret Schundler was running for Governor and seeking support among some of his staunchest supporters, the legislators in Morris County.

When Highlands at Morris, a 1,040-unit development being built on the banks of the Rockaway River was proposed, Mayor Schundler said nothing. Highlands at Morris was picked by the Sierra Club as one of the worst sprawl projects in New Jersey in 2000. Not only was it one of the largest projects in New Jersey, but there was a history of wetland violations on the site as well. This project was considered so bad that the Rockaway Valley Sewerage Authority even sued to try to stop this project. But with all the violations and lawsuits, Jersey City under Bret Schundler did nothing.

They are also in some of the fastest growing communities in northern New Jersey. Local citizen groups and municipalities have been fighting battles to try and stop sprawl and over development from paving over this area. Even though this area directly affects Jersey City's reservoirs, Mayor Bret Schundler has never worked to support these local battles against sprawl and protection of water. Coincidentally, many of the largest developers building in the watershed of the Boonton and Split Rock Reservoirs, Hovnanian and Toll Brothers for example, are also some of the largest contributors to the Schundler for Governor campaign.

They were already protected because of the watershed moratorium. You will find instead that he sold these properties to get money to help Jersey City balance its budget. After years of trying to get rid of these properties because he wanted money for them but could not sell them to developers because of the moratorium, he was able to get the State of New Jersey to spend $6.8 million dollars of taxpayer money to buy properties that couldn't be developed. Included in that sale was Camp Hudsonia, a former Girl Scout's camp, owned by Jersey City and used by Jersey City residents. He did not use any of the moneys to buy other lands to help protect Jersey City's reservoirs. Nor did he support a 10 year attempt by residents in Denville to buy back former Jersey City watershed properties that had been sold off by the City, costing taxpayers $6.5 million dollars.

He opposes the new DEP regulations that protect ground water from septic systems. He opposes upgrading reservoir and water supply stream classifications and the additional protections that come with that. He opposes legislation that would protect reservoirs from development on steep slopes. He opposes regulations that would limit sewer extensions in environmentally sensitive areas. He believes that towns, not the DEP, should decide on where sewers should go, no matter what the impact would be to reservoirs. He does not support stronger watershed planning rules that would clean up our rivers and help protect our waterways from sprawl and over development.

The septic rule was written by Governor Whitman and signed by Governor De Francesco. The reservoir protection bill was sponsored by Assemblymen Lance and Coredemus, and has 66 co-sponsors from both parties. Assemblyman John Rooney, an early Schundler supporter, sponsors the steep slope protection bill.

The Club noted that not only did Schundler fail to protect the Jersey City water supply; he also failed to protect Jersey City's water ratepayers, who, as a result of Schundler's policies, will subsidize Morris County golfers.

It is a Natural Heritage Priority Site with endangered species on Bowling Green Mountain. The course construction destroyed steep sloped forested lands; thereby increasing polluted stormwater runoff and reducing water quality in the reservoir's tributary streams. Additionally, the operation of the golf course will add toxic pesticides and fertilizers to the reservoir.

To compensate Jersey City for the golf course's use of the City's water supply, DEP's draft water diversion permit stated that "This permit shall not become effective unless and until the permittee [Morris County] enters into a contract with Jersey City for the consumptive portion [90%] of their water use" (NJDEP, 6/18/01 Draft Staff Report - water diversion permit #2520P). Morris County officials, led by State Senator Bucco, other legislators and Freeholders - including direct intervention and support for expediting the approvals of the project by the Acting Governor's Office - strenuously opposed this compensation requirement. DEP caved in to this political pressure.

In approving the final water diversion permit on August 1, 2001, DEP eliminated the Jersey City compensation requirement, justified, in part, by the fact that no comments were submitted by United Water Jersey City [the operator of Jersey City's water supply system] (see page 8 of August 1, 2001 Hearing Officer's Report). However, the hearings and the meetings took place between January and the end of June, 2001 while Bret Schundler was still Mayor and a candidate for the Republican nomination for Governor.
